Hello,
Used boat, New to me.
Has anyone ever replaced the ballast pumps on a 2002 216? My boat is the "team edition" which includes the push button fill option. When I push the button to fill, my battery volts go to zero. About 3 seconds later the breaker will pop.... The pumps don't seem to be humming at all. Sea cocks were open.

1) pumps shot?
2) bad ground wire?

Thoughts?

I read reviews that the Tsunami 800GPH will replace them. But I am not sure if I'm ready to embark on a weekend warrior project.

Sean,
I just had another thought!! Is it possible that the pumps were never drained/winterized and over winter they were freeze damaged?

I believe my '03 has the Tsunami pumps on the fill side. Mine's not a direct drive so it'll be in a different location. Mine are a hassle to reach, but so is almost everything on a v-drive, except, naturally, the v-drive itself. And maybe the distributor cap. That's about it haha.

Just make sure when you get a replacement that the intake and output sizes are the same as what's in your boat, if you do get a different model of pump.
